Back in the late 60's we were allowed to use calculators for homework but weren't allowed to bring calculators to tests in Engineering at Mizzou. We had to bring slide rules. Accuracy with a slide rule (as I recall) was three significant digits. Many students at that time didn't own calculators; they were pretty pricey. Today most phones will do everything a $300 calculator would do back then. And (if they still make them) a $4 calculator will also.
